For explanations of most columns above, including the EJ Shares, see the technical notes.

For the Rv (revisions) column,
* indicates that the record contains one or more chemicals at facilities whose TRI air releases or incineration transfers for 2006 were revised downwards since 2006, and whose hazard and score have been adjusted accordingly.
** indicates one or more chemicals at facilities whose quantities were revised upwards, or both upwards and downwards. Chemicals revised upwards had their pounds adjusted, but not their score.
*** indicates that the RSEI microdata do not match the public RSEI data.
